Biography

About

Nǃxau ǂToma was born around 1944 and lived as a farmer in the Namibian bush before being cast in The Gods Must Be Crazy in 1980. In the film he played Xixo, a role that made him what The Namibian would call "Namibia's most famous actor" despite having no prior connection to cinema. He reprised the character in sequels, carrying a story that reached audiences worldwide while he remained rooted in a life far from Hollywood. He died on 5 July 2003.
